    @flyingtoaster I have resolved yes. As mentioned here it could be caused by a number of things, For me I had to go into the Temp folder properties - Security tab - and Add myself to the Group or User Names section. There are YT videos to show you how if you dont know how. Again that was my problem..yours could be something else.
